In England and Wales, a right to light is usually gotten by prescription-- simply put, when light has been appreciated for an undisturbed period of twenty years with the windows of the structure. Once gotten, the right to light expands only to a particular amount of light such as appropriates for the continuous use and pleasure of the building, and is not a right to all the light that was once delighted in. In Power v Shah, the building owner claimed that they thought the PWA 1996 really did not relate to their jobs, for this reason their failing to offer notification (itself a breach of statutory obligation). It shows up that they were wrong, and any kind of structure proprietor that skips the opportunity to serve notifications under the PWA 1996 denies themselves of the rights and protections managed to a building owner under the Act. This includes a right to go into upon the adjacent owner's land and a right to have any disagreement with their neighbour settled under the section 10 procedure by independent and specialist party wall surface surveyors. In this case, the building owner (Mr Shah) undertook jobs to his residential or commercial property without offering notification After suffering damage, the adjacent owner assigned a party wall surface surveyor that then appointed a land surveyor in support of Mr Shah under the default procedure of the Act. Exactly how do I dispute an event wall surface contract?

You can appeal versus an Honor at a Region Court, yet it has to be within 14 days of it being served. You will require to submit an applicant''s notification at the Area Court, discussing why you''re appealing. It is reasonable for lawyers to encourage you on any such charm and to prepare the application for you.
